Transaction 2e627123b08aea3c893d9218b8ae66fc5f105ca1d7845e006d7af62752f7e07a

1 Input
2 Outputs
  • 2e627123b08aea3c893d9218b8ae66fc5f105ca1d7845e006d7af62752f7e07a:0
  • value  2809150
    address  3D7WaHumhwYT5YGS2EwGmUMn3P3yE4rrNi
  • 2e627123b08aea3c893d9218b8ae66fc5f105ca1d7845e006d7af62752f7e07a:1
  • value  1443626
    address  3AATHXNwtgWpUVF6tdViB6cn3LtovNZryk